A machine for agreement

Strip away the noise and Bitcoin is one idea: thousands of strangers keeping the same ledger, with no referee, and catching anyone who cheats. Three mechanisms make that possible.

One ledger, everywhere

Every full node keeps a complete copy of every transaction since 2009. There is no master copy to corrupt, seize or quietly edit. To rewrite the record you would have to rewrite everyone's record at once.

Blocks, chained by hashes

Transactions are packed into blocks, roughly one every ten minutes. Each block carries the of the one before it, welding history together: touch one block and every block after it breaks.

Proof of work

Miners race to find a rare hash for the next block, burning real electricity to do it. That is : winning costs money, and lying costs the same money for nothing. Honesty is simply the only trade that pays.

21,000,000, forever

Central banks meet to decide how much money exists. Bitcoin decided once, in 2008, and wrote it into the software: 21 million coins, issued on a schedule that ends around 2140. No committee can vote it higher.

21,000,000 cap 95.5% already issued 2009 2012 2016 2020 2024 2028 → ~2140 0

Each dashed line is a halving: the block reward cut in half, on schedule, every 210,000 blocks. Four have happened exactly as written in 2008. The fifth arrives at block 1,050,000.

Seventeen years on the record

Bitcoin's history is public in a way no other financial system's is: every boom, every fraud, every block, preserved. Thirteen moments that made it, including the ugly ones.

  • 31 Oct 2008

    Bitcoin whitepaper published

    The pseudonymous Satoshi Nakamoto posted 'Bitcoin: A Peer-to-Peer Electronic Cash System' to a cryptography mailing list, describing a decentralized digital currency secured by proof-of-work.

  • 3 Jan 2009

    Genesis block mined

    Satoshi Nakamoto mined block 0, launching the Bitcoin network and embedding the headline 'Chancellor on brink of second bailout for banks' in the coinbase.

  • 22 May 2010

    Bitcoin Pizza Day

    Laszlo Hanyecz paid 10,000 BTC for two pizzas, the first documented purchase of a physical good with Bitcoin and now an annual community celebration.

  • 9 Feb 2011

    Bitcoin reaches dollar parity

    Bitcoin's price reached parity with the US dollar (1 BTC = $1) for the first time.

  • 28 Nov 2012

    First Bitcoin halving

    At block 210,000 the block reward dropped from 50 BTC to 25 BTC, the first of Bitcoin's scheduled reductions in new supply.

  • 28 Feb 2014

    Mt. Gox collapses

    Mt. Gox, then handling most Bitcoin trades, halted withdrawals and filed for bankruptcy after losing roughly 850,000 BTC to theft.

  • 17 Dec 2017

    Bitcoin nears $20,000

    Bitcoin peaked at about $19,783, capping a roughly 20x run during 2017 before a long bear market began.

  • 7 Sep 2021

    Bitcoin becomes legal tender in El Salvador

    El Salvador's Bitcoin Law took effect, making it the first nation where Bitcoin was legal tender alongside the US dollar, backed by the state-run Chivo wallet.

  • 11 Nov 2022

    FTX collapses

    The FTX exchange filed for bankruptcy after an ~$8 billion shortfall was exposed, sending Bitcoin to multi-year lows and badly damaging industry trust.

  • 10 Jan 2024

    SEC approves spot Bitcoin ETFs

    The SEC approved 11 spot Bitcoin ETFs from issuers including BlackRock, Fidelity and Grayscale; they began trading the next day with record volumes.

  • 5 Dec 2024

    Bitcoin crosses $100,000

    Bitcoin surpassed $100,000 for the first time amid post-election optimism and strong spot-ETF demand.

  • 6 Mar 2025

    US Strategic Bitcoin Reserve created

    President Trump signed an executive order establishing a Strategic Bitcoin Reserve, to hold bitcoin seized in federal cases as a long-term reserve asset, plus a broader digital-asset stockpile.

Hash

A one-way fingerprint. SHA-256 turns any input into 256 bits: the same input always gives the same output, but there is no way back and no way to predict the output without running it. Try it in the lab below.

Proof of work

Evidence, checkable in microseconds, that enormous computation was spent. Producing it is brutally hard; verifying it is trivial. That asymmetry is what secures the ledger.

Nonce

A number miners change over and over to get a fresh hash of the same block. Mining is nothing more exotic than trying nonces until the block's hash lands below the network's target.

Halving

Every 210,000 blocks, roughly four years, the reward for mining a block is cut in half. It is Bitcoin's entire monetary policy: published in 2008, executed on schedule ever since.
